They Traded America for a Remote Archipelago. Now They’re Moving Back.
The couple is listing their Norwegian farmhouse after culture shock and logistical challenges prompted a return to Montana
CHARLES POST
July 7, 2026 1:45 pm ET
An American couple who spent more than six years and tens of thousands of dollars living out an Arctic real-estate fantasy is making a U-turn on their expatriate experiment.
